Johannesburg - Christmas is a time for friends and family to get together and create special and often timeless memories.
And it was no different for Joost van der Westhuizen and his estranged wife Amor Vittone, who spent Christmas together with their kids this year.
A frail looking Joost posed with his children and Amor for Christmas morning snaps, which were later uploaded to social media by Amor.
Amor had taken the kids away to Mauritius for a quick break before Christmas, but they all returned in time to spend the special day with Joost.
It comes after recent reports in YOU magazine which suggest Joost may have signed up to trial a new treatment that could possibly cure his motor neuron disease
According to the magazine, Joost is part of a group of sufferers who have been approved to undergo the treatment on compassionate grounds - all in the hopes that it will allow him to spend many more special days with his family.
